Chapter 217 The Incense Burning Sect Incident
Chapter 217 The Incense Burning Sect Incident
The Green Coffin Mountain trembled violently, and Lu Xingzhou gave the order.
The two events combined put the entire Incense Burning Sect on edge.
Everyone knows what is suppressed beneath Green Coffin Mountain. Could the long-rumored resurrection of the Demon Lord Wujiu really be becoming a reality?
Mo Suixin had no time for divination and could only obey orders to rush to the Demon Suppression Palace.
The Demon-Suppressing Palace is located in the southeastern part of the 800-li Green Coffin Mountain.
When Mo Suixin rushed there, she happened to run into her master, Pang Duoduo.
However, the Pang Duoduo in front of me was completely different from the usual sleepy-eyed and disheveled woman!
Her once flowing, cascading hair was now meticulously combed into a dignified and elegant Taoist bun. Her ever-present loose-fitting sleeping robe had been replaced with a solemn, dark black Taoist robe.
Upon seeing her master dressed in such formal attire, Mo Suixin was so surprised that she almost thought she had mistaken him for someone else. She quickly stepped forward to pay her respects and couldn't help but ask, "Master, you are dressed so solemnly today. Has something really happened at Green Coffin Mountain?"
Pang Duoduo glanced at her, but her tone remained somewhat nonchalant: "Of course it's a big deal, otherwise do you think the sect leader would call all the managers of the Three Mountains and Five Halls together for a meeting? However, the reason I changed into this outfit is not because the matter is so important, but simply because that gossipy old man from the Longevity Hall has been spreading rumors, saying that I have behaved improperly and disgraced the Burning Incense Sect."
Mo Suixin was in no mood for jokes at the moment, and quickly told Pang Duoduo what Chen Yexin had mentioned.
Pang Duoduo frowned upon hearing this and couldn't help but say, "How come you always seem to run into all sorts of trouble, you little devil?"
Mo Suixin blushed and said, "Whose enemy is this? Master, don't talk nonsense."
"Alright, alright, I'm too lazy to tease you today. Chen Ye is a man with some luck on his side. The recent changes in the celestial phenomena were also related to him. The relationship between the Qinghe Sword Sect and this man has become even stranger, but the entanglement has also deepened. I didn't expect that Chen Ye would even get involved with the karma of our Fenxiang Sect. The demon he encountered must be related to our Fenxiang Sect."
Pang Duoduo said to Mo Suixin, "Disciple, there is still one divination you haven't performed today, isn't there?"
Mo Suixin nodded and said, "Disciple is about to perform the divination, but the sect leader has summoned me. If Master wants me to perform the divination now..."
Pang Duoduo shook her head and said, "No, don't calculate it. From today onwards, do whatever the sect leader tells you to do, and pretend you don't hear or see anything else. Don't try to predict the past or the future."
Mo Suixin frowned, but did not ask for the reason. He simply nodded and said, "Disciple obeys."
Both master and apprentice were top-notch diviners in the world. They would say what they could say clearly, and if they couldn't say something, then it meant they couldn't say it.
The master and disciple were of one mind, requiring no further explanation.
Pang Duoduo smiled and said, "Alright, this is your first time visiting the Demon Suppression Palace, isn't it? Do you know what this place is?"
Mo Suixin replied, "I've heard that the Demon Suppression Palace is the central sealing point of the entire Green Coffin Mountain, pressing down on the head of the corpse of Demon Lord Wujiu. However, I have never actually seen the true appearance of the Demon Suppression Palace."
"Though it may not be perfect, it's not far off. The Demon Suppression Palace is indeed the central hub of the seal, but it's not pressing down on your head. When the time comes, you'll have to hold back and not embarrass our Seven Star Hall."
Before Mo Suixin could understand what he was saying, the master and disciple had already arrived at the gate of the Demon Suppression Palace.
This is a palace carved entirely from white jade, from the steps under your feet to the huge pillars supporting the hall, and then to the roof with its layers of flying eaves and brackets.
Mo Suixin looked closely and couldn't see a single crack. It was as if the huge palace was a single piece of flawless white jade that had been hollowed out to form the shape of the palace.
The plaque that proclaims the suppression of demons and evil spirits hangs high, emitting a faint glow, and looks magnificent and imposing.
This was Mo Suixin's first time visiting the Demon Suppression Palace. Previously, this place was a sacred area of the sect, and only the hall masters of the Three Mountains and Five Halls, the sect leader, and a few elders with special status could enter and exit. Even the chief disciple was not allowed to approach it at will.
But today the sect leader has summoned all the chief disciples of the Incense Burning Sect, which means something really big has happened.
Do not follow Pang Duoduo's orders blindly; do not look too much, do not think too much, and do not ask too many questions.
He silently followed behind Pang Duoduo and entered the white jade palace.
As they ventured deeper into the palace, they encountered many fellow disciples, though Mo Suixin did not recognize most of them.
The Three Mountains and Five Halls refer to Xuantian Mountain, Xingxuan Mountain, and Fenxin Mountain, which are three meticulously designed peaks within the Fenxiang Sect and the core of the mountain-protecting formation.
Burning Heart Mountain is also the training ground of Sect Leader Lu Xingzhou, and the place where the Burning Incense Sect discusses matters large and small on a daily basis.
The disciples of Xuantian Mountain and Xingxuan Mountain, besides shouldering the responsibility of guarding the great formation, usually devote themselves to cultivating various combat techniques and supernatural abilities, and are the backbone of the Burning Incense Sect in slaying demons and eliminating evil.
The five halls are the Hall of Longevity, the Hall of Seven Stars, the Hall of Melting Gold, the Hall of Spirit Beasts, and the Hall of Hundred Crafts.
The Hall of Longevity specializes in alchemy and cultivating various spiritual plants; the Hall of Seven Stars specializes in divination of the past and future and deducing formations; the Hall of Melting Gold is where magical treasures are forged; the Hall of Spiritual Beasts is dedicated to raising various spiritual beast mounts; and the Hall of a Hundred Crafts is the most diverse, where mechanical puppets, talisman drawing, Gu refining, and other miscellaneous skills are all taught.
Among the five major righteous sects, the Incense Burning Sect has the most disciples and is also the strongest.
The Three Mountains and Five Halls each have their own duties, but the Seven Star Hall has the fewest disciples and interacts with the least with others.
Because of the various bad rumors surrounding the Seven Star Hall, many disciples of the Incense Burning Sect avoided Pang Duoduo and her master. When the two stood in the main hall, they were shunned by everyone, looking rather desolate.
But neither Pang Duoduo nor Mo Suixin cared; that's just how fortune tellers are.
Everyone wants to avoid misfortune and seek good fortune, but some misfortunes are unavoidable and can only be silently accepted.
If they do not get the desired result after consulting the oracle, they will blame the diviner.
Such is the nature of human nature, and even cultivators are no different.
People gathered in small groups, mostly looking worried, talking about the previous earthquake.
The hall fell silent the moment a long, resonant sound of a jade chime rang out.
Lu Xingzhou, the leader of the Incense Burning Sect, walked slowly out from the back of the main hall, surrounded by several elders.
Everyone bowed in unison: "Greetings, Sect Leader!"
Lu Xingzhou waved his hand, indicating that everyone should dispense with the formalities. His face looked somewhat tired, but his eyes remained sharp as an eagle's. Before the pleasantries could be finished, he went straight to the point, his voice deep and resonant:
"You are all pillars of our Incense Burning Sect. You have all heard some of the recent rumors about the imminent resurrection of the Demon Lord Wujiu."
"The reason I have summoned you all here today is to make it clear to you that those rumors are not unfounded! The physical body of the Demon Lord Wujiu is indeed mutating and showing signs of resurgence."
Everyone was taken aback by what Lu Xingzhou said.
Lu Xingzhou looked around, his gaze sweeping across the faces of the crowd. Although he saw many expressions of worry and surprise, none of the disciples of the Burning Incense Sect showed any fear.
A great school of martial arts with a history spanning millennia ultimately possesses its own profound heritage.
After a brief murmur, Ren Hongchuan, the head of the Changsheng Hall, stroked his long, white beard and said to Lu Xingzhou, "Sect Leader, even if the Demon Lord Wujiu were to be resurrected immediately, our Fenxiang Sect would simply be repeating the old story of slaying demons and monsters."
Everyone responded in unison.
He's just a demon lord who was buried by the Incense Burning Sect and planted with flowers for over a thousand years. Even if he comes back to life, what can he do?
Lu Xingzhou nodded and said, "Indeed, worthy of being disciples of my Burning Incense Sect. I have summoned you all here today to reinforce the seal. The reinforcement of the seal will be a joint effort between me and the sect elders, with you junior disciples protecting us. You must cooperate fully this time, and there can be no mistakes." The Burning Incense Sect disciples responded in unison, "We will obey the sect leader's orders!"
"Alright, then follow me."
Lu Xingzhou turned around and led the group deeper into the Demon Suppression Palace.
After passing through the layers of halls and corridors of the Demon Suppression Palace, we finally arrived at the entrance to a dark and gloomy underground passage.
The tunnel stretched downwards, its bottom invisible.
As the group continued to descend, a nauseating stench slowly filled the air, the smell of blood and decay growing stronger.
I don't know how deep we went down; this tunnel seemed to have a bewitching effect, causing our five senses to become disordered.
The further down you go, the stronger the dizziness becomes, as if someone is whispering in your ears, saying things you can't understand.
The disciples of the Incense Burning Sect with weaker cultivation levels all frowned, forced to guard their minds and barely maintain their rationality.
After walking for an unknown amount of time, their vision suddenly opened up, and they arrived at a vast space that was indescribably bizarre and disgusting.
This was a large hall constructed of flesh and blood, seemingly much larger than the Demon Suppression Palace, with walls made of fascia and pinkish soft flesh. A viscous, dark red liquid continuously seeped and dripped from the fleshy walls, converging into streams of blood-red liquid, which were eventually absorbed by the flesh and blood beneath one's feet.
Stepping on the soft, yielding ground, Mo Suixin felt nauseous.
She now understood why it was said that the Demon Suppression Palace was nailed to the forehead of the Demon Lord Wujiu. This was not an exaggeration or a metaphor, but truly like a nail piercing through the Demon Lord Wujiu's head.
And everyone should now be inside the mind of the Demon Lord Wujiu.
The 800-mile-long Green Coffin Mountain only suppresses one corpse, which is this Demon Lord Wujiu.
After everyone calmed down a bit, Lu Xingzhou said, "Many of you are here for the first time in the underground of the Demon Suppression Palace, but you should be able to recognize the flowers on the wall."
Mo Suixin looked around and saw that the disgusting flesh and blood were covered with pure white flowers, which were the most famous treasure of the Burning Incense Sect - the Soul Cleansing Flower.
Mo Suixin never expected that the Soul Cleansing Flower grew in the brain of the Demon Lord Wujiu, and why there were so many of them.
At first glance, thousands of Soul Cleansing Flowers were growing in this cavity.
In the past, the Incense Burning Sect could only harvest a handful of Soul Cleansing Flowers each year. It was only in recent years, when the Incense Burning Sect recruited many rogue cultivators and needed a large number of Soul Cleansing Flowers, that the harvesting quantity doubled.
According to Pang Duoduo, it was precisely because so many were harvested that the Demon Lord Wujiu was revived.
But the number of these thousands of Soul Cleansing Flowers doesn't seem to match up.
Mo Suixin looked at her master with a puzzled expression, and Pang Duoduo whispered a reminder: "Look carefully at the color."
Mo Suixin focused his gaze and quickly discovered the problem: among the thousands of Soul Cleansing Flowers, only a few dozen were pure white, while the other Soul Cleansing Flowers had dark red veins on their petals.
Mo Suixin remembered that the Soul Cleansing Flower should be pure white. If there were only a few dozen real Soul Cleansing Flowers, then what were the remaining thousands?
Lu Xingzhou quickly explained to everyone: "Upon careful examination, those Soul Cleansing Flowers with blood-red patterns are the ones that have recently grown. It was these mutated Soul Cleansing Flowers that shook the seal, causing the corpse of the Demon Lord Wujiu to tremble. Now the seal is damaged and needs to be repaired. In the meantime, you must be careful of these blood-red Soul Cleansing Flowers."
"As you all know, every time you pick the Soul Cleansing Flower, there is a life-or-death danger. In the past, your elders protected you, but this time, it's up to you. Guard this talisman until we repair the seal."
With a wave of his hand, Lu Xingzhou revealed layers of spatial rifts, within which countless profound runes were created and destroyed.
A talisman formed from golden light floated out and enveloped everyone.
Within the reach of the golden light, everyone felt refreshed, and the whispers that had been polluting their spirits disappeared.
At this moment, everyone could see the broken formation in the sky. Even if they couldn't see the whole picture, they could tell that the seal was indeed in grave danger.
Lu Xingzhou took the initiative to walk into one of the cracks, and the other sect elders followed closely behind.
Pang Duoduo seemed to have known all along, and she also chose a crack to fly into it. Before disappearing, she said to Mo Suixin, "Remember, do not divine the past or the future."
Mo Suixin nodded, keeping these words in mind.
The elders entered the sealing formation to repair it, and the spatial rift disappeared, leaving only the chief disciples of the Three Mountains and Five Halls, and the talisman in the center that kept emitting golden light.
So, as long as we protect this talisman well, we can wait for the sect leader to emerge from seclusion?
Mo Suixin looked around at the Soul Cleansing Flowers and couldn't help but feel worried. She had never picked Soul Cleansing Flowers before and didn't know what dangers she might encounter.
But at this moment, the chief disciples of the Three Mountains and Five Halls all looked at Mo Suixin.
It is common practice to consult divination before a major battle.
Since no one knows what dangers may lie ahead, it is natural to ask Mo Suixin, the diviner, to predict the future so that everyone can be prepared.
But seeing that Mo Suixin remained silent, Ren Yaosheng, the newly appointed chief disciple of the Longevity Hall, spoke up: "Senior Sister Mo, no matter what unpleasant things we may have had in the past, this is a matter of life and death, concerning the survival of the Incense Burning Sect. As the chief disciple of the Seven Star Hall, shouldn't you fulfill your duties?"
This Ren Yaosheng seems to be a blood relative of Ren Hongchuan, the head of the Changsheng Hall, though it's unclear how many generations removed they are. The head of the Changsheng Hall should have been Wei Changsheng, but he was executed, so Ren Yaosheng was promoted instead.
Mo Suixin sneered, "Chang Sheng Tang is indeed a treacherous organization that has inherited the same vicious ways."
No matter what Mo Suixin calculates, if he's right, it means Changsheng Hall forced him to give in; if he's wrong, it means Mo Suixin harbors resentment and seeks revenge.
However, since her master had repeatedly warned her not to predict the future, she would never do it. She simply said casually, "The Hall of Longevity speaks grand words, but they never believe in the results of divination."
Ren Yaosheng said, "How could that be? We know Sister Mo's abilities. Now, please calculate the fortune."
Mo Suixin replied, "What if I told you that I knew you were doomed to die? What would you do then?"
Ren Yaosheng's face immediately darkened, and he said to Mo Suixin, "Senior Sister, do you have to be so childish at a time like this?"
Mo Suixin shook his head and said, "You see, even if I told you, you wouldn't believe me. It's not just you; everyone knows in their hearts that I'm only happy when everything goes well. If I were to predict which of you will die a violent death, you would want to kill me right now to defy fate."
"In that case, whatever I calculate, it's best not to say it. If you trust me, then follow my instructions. If you don't trust me, then don't press me about what I've calculated, lest you panic and lose your grip on your swords."
Upon hearing this, the other disciples of the Incense Burning Sect all changed their expressions.
Mo Suixin ignored it and took out her magic compass to calculate the direction.
The future fortune or misfortune cannot be predicted, but the direction of spiritual energy and the four cardinal directions must be determined.
The Seven Star Hall is not only good at divination, but also the best at setting up formations in the Incense Burning Sect.
